Recognizing Mold Development Aspects



The key variable adding to mold and mildew development is wetness. Mold and mildew spores need wetness to prosper and germinate, making humid or damp environments highly vulnerable to mold infestations.

An additional considerable element is temperature. Mold and mildew has a tendency to multiply in temperatures between 77 to 86 levels Fahrenheit, although it can still expand in a broader array. In addition, mold and mildew needs raw material to eat. This can consist of various structure products such as drywall, wood, and insulation. Routinely evaluating and preserving these materials can aid stop mold development.


In addition, airflow and light exposure can influence mold growth. Locations that lack proper air flow and all-natural light are a lot more vulnerable to mold advancement. By addressing these elements adequately, individuals can successfully mitigate mold development and safeguard their living atmospheres.


Correct Mold Cleaning Methods



Utilizing effective cleansing approaches is vital in protecting against the recurrence and attending to of mold and mildew contamination in interior environments. When taking care of mold and mildew, it is crucial to prioritize security by putting on safety equipment such as handwear covers, safety glasses, and masks. The first step in appropriate mold cleaning is to consist of the afflicted location to stop the spread of spores to unpolluted locations. This can be attained by sealing the space and using air scrubbers or negative air machines to maintain air quality.

Next, complete cleaning of surfaces is necessary to eliminate mold and mildew growth effectively. Non-porous materials can normally be cleaned up with a cleaning agent service and scrubbing, while permeable materials might need extra extensive approaches such as HEPA vacuuming or removal and substitute. It is important to dry out the cleaned up area entirely to stop mold and mildew re-growth. After cleaning, using antimicrobial solutions can aid inhibit mold and mildew growth and stop future contamination. Regular examinations and maintenance are likewise important to capture any type of mold and mildew issues early and resolve them promptly. By complying with these proper mold cleansing techniques, you can make certain a mold-free and healthy indoor setting.


Applying Moisture Control Procedures



To effectively avoid mold and mildew growth and contamination in indoor settings, applying moisture control procedures is paramount. Wetness is the main factor that fuels mold and mildew development, making it important to take care of humidity levels within the home. One efficient action is to use dehumidifiers to preserve interior moisture degrees listed below 60%. Additionally, guaranteeing correct ventilation in areas prone to moisture buildup, such as kitchen areas and shower rooms, can aid lower the threat of mold and mildew development. Routinely evaluating and fixing any type of leaks in pipes, roofings, or windows is likewise crucial in protecting against excess moisture accumulation. Using exhaust followers while food preparation or showering, and allowing air blood circulation by maintaining furniture slightly far from wall surfaces can help in moisture control.
